Handover — Corvane Street Lease

From Harrell to Dunmore. Status: Pellwick Estates countered at 8% uplift, ten-year term. Our ceiling remains 5% with a five-year break. Legal has reviewed; no dealbreakers. Next meeting set for the 14th. Heads of department: hold all space requests until terms close. Do not circulate. The reasoning behind our ceiling is stated below.

confidential, kagep-kahof: Druokax Systems plans to lower the Ulaath list price by 53 percent in March.

# Handover: Greenhouse Controller Sensor Drift

For the eng sync — handing Verdalis controller work from me (Tomas) to Priya. The humidity sensors in bay three drift upward roughly 2% per week; the compensation curve I added masks it but doesn't fix root cause, likely condensation on the probe housings. Recalibration script runs Sundays; watch its logs. To access the calibration console on the field gateway, enter the recovery passphrase below.

recovery phrase for fajep-yaweg: gilath-sorox-wenius-rusdor-keliel-zorius

The leak in Pictohoard's image cache stemmed from evicted entries retaining decoded bitmaps when `PICTOHOARD_EVICT_MODE` was left unset. Future maintainers should always set it to `strict` in production. Related knobs: `PICTOHOARD_CACHE_MAX_MB` bounds resident memory, and `PICTOHOARD_SWEEP_INTERVAL` controls the reaper cadence. The cache telemetry agent, which confirmed the fix, reports to the Hexwall collector and must authenticate on startup. Its credential goes on the next line of the env file:

secret setting of tawig-fafop: ARCHIVE_KEY3=e9c